Following a review of what happened at the November Board of Directors meeting, we discussed having an ECR or TCPC race inside of the 13 Hour enduro in October. The idea is that the 13 Hour gang would get first crack at entry spots and if there was room in the paddock for more cars to pit, then add a shorter enduro class to fill up the field. This format has been run at Road Atlanta for quite some time, the ECR and the Pro It being run at the same time, when the 45 minute Pro It is over they give them a flag and they come in, race done. The ECR continues for the normal time. Go figure, everyone gets more racing, the track stays busy, the corner workers see more action,  a happy SCCA group. Give this some thought and let your Member-at-Large, Chapter Coordinator or other Comp board member know what you think about this option for more track time.
